PSPlant will use the same authentication mechanism as the main PresetCentral.com website.
This means your account on PresetCentral.com will also work on PSPlant. Its easy, one account, one password to remember!

PSPlant will allow you to tag your presets before sharing them on PresetCentral.com.
You can tag them by entering some pre-defined text in the comments field or/and add an image tag to the thumbnail.
After all you want people to know who’s presets they are using!!

PSPlant will allow you to pick a preset on PresetCentral and use it within Lightwave3D with a single click.

PSPlant will allow you to modify your presets without Lightwave3D. You can change the name, description, comments and even the thumbnail, but more on that later.
